This engaging coloring book introduces young readers to the unique wildlife of Hawai'i, combining fun activities with educational content. Designed for ages 5-8 and early readers, it offers a gentle exploration of nature and culture appropriate for this age group. Parents can expect a safe, informative experience that encourages creativity and learning without any intense content.
